annotate pithya_components.xml @ 0:bc3c2b38d783 draft default tip

plan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
author sybila
date Thu, 06 Oct 2022 09:50:39 +0000
parents
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
1 <tool id="pithya_components" name="PITHYA components" version="@TOOL_VERSION@_galaxy0">
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
2 <description>- computes terminal components</description>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
3 <macros>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
4 <import>macros.xml</import>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
5 </macros>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
6 <expand macro="creator"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
7 <requirements>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
8 <container type="docker">sybila/pithya:@TOOL_VERSION@</container>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
9 </requirements>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
10 <command>pithyaComponents
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
11 -m '$input_model'
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
12 --parallelism '$threads'
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
13 #if $cut_thrs
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
14 --cut-to-range
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
15 #end if
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
16 --algorithm-type 'local'
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
17 -ro '$output'
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
18 -lo 'stdout'
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
19 </command>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
20
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
21 <inputs>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
22 <param format="pithya.model" name="input_model" type="data" label="Pithya model file."/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
23 <param type="boolean" name="cut_thrs" checked="false" label="Cut the thresholds"
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
24 help="...exceeding explicit minimum and maximum thresholds" />
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
25 <param name="threads" size="2" type="integer" min="1" max="32" value="2" label="Number of threads used for parallelism." />
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
26 </inputs>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
27
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
28 <outputs>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
29 <data format="pithya.result" name="output" />
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
30 </outputs>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
31
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
32 <tests>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
33 <test>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
34 <param name="input_model" value="example_components.pithya.model"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
35 <output name="output">
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
36 <assert_contents>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
37 <has_text text="results"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
38 <has_text text="variables"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
39 <has_text text="parameters"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
40 <has_text text="thresholds"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
41 <has_text text="parameter_bounds"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
42 <has_text text="states"/>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
43 </assert_contents>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
44 </output>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
45 </test>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
46 </tests>
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
47
bc3c2b38d783 planemo upload for repository https://github.com/sybila/galaxytools/tree/main/tools/pithya commit 13d53c7fcc8541a4d3f1e19bfd607245554eedd8
sybila
parents:
diff changeset
48 </tool>